Abstract
An integral aft seal for sealing the interface between a gas turbine transition piece and first stage nozzle exhibits sufficient variable thickness to adjust for relative component movement. The seal comprises a contiguous material having opposing planar faces and stiffeners attached at each of the faces. The contiguous material has corrugations to provide variable thickness. The stiffeners are attached to the planar faces of the contiguous material and generally have the same planar shape as the seal. Flexibility in the thickness dimension due to the corrugations biases the stiffeners away from one another and into contact with the turbine components. The aft seal is affixed to the transition piece by an attachment structure that eliminates relative movement between the seal and the transition piece to thereby eliminate wear.
